Bearing Material and Lubrication
6203 bearings are typically manufactured using chrome steel for durability and corrosion resistance. They are also pre-lubricated with high-quality grease to ensure smooth operation and extend their lifespan.
Bearing Load Capacity and Speed
The load capacity and speed limit of a 6203 bearing depend on factors such as the bearing material, grease type, and operating conditions. Generally, 6203 bearings have a dynamic load capacity of 12.7 kN and a maximum speed of 10,000 rpm.
